This print captures the serene beauty of Monkshood (aconitum) flowers blooming in front of St. James Church, located in the small preserved fishing village of Battle Harbour, Labrador, Canada. The image showcases a harmonious blend of tradition and nature against the backdrop of a charming harbor. The architectural heritage is evident as we admire the wooden structure and historic tower that have withstood the test of time since the 19th century. This place of worship holds great significance to this close-knit community, reflecting their deep-rooted Christian beliefs.
